I used to be heavily into target shooting. It's a sport, and one that requires a lot of discipline. The emphasis is on the sport, not the love of guns.

I have also done some clay pigeon shooting, but it is never something I have ever really enjoyed.

Gun control in the UK is extremely strict. You will get a 5 years mandatory sentence for merely possessing an unlicensed firearm (Criminal Justice Act 2003). For those who are issued with a firearms licence (which itself is extremely restrictive), there are very strict rules regarding gun and ammunition storage, with heavy sanctions for those who disobey them, and the police carry out regular and unannounced checks.

It really does not pay to be a "gun nut" in the UK.

Did you do target shooting with automatic or semi automatic weapons, you can tell the diffrence by the sound dontcha know?

Not as part of my main sport - those types of weapons have long been banned in the UK, and further controls were introduced with the banning of semi-automatic handguns, following the Dunblane massacre, in 1996.

However, I have fired a number of fully automatic and semi-automatic weapons outside the UK.
